As part of a free weekend programme of music, theatre, dance, arts, crafts and food, Artillery was invited to curate the moated island in Lloyd Park for the Walthamstow Garden Party produced by Create and Barbican. Becoming a member - list temporarily closed. To join the Society and have your name added to the waiting list. You must be a resident of the London Borough of Hackney. Membership of the Society is currently 4 per annum, renewable on 1st October each year. As a member, you will receive regular newsletters, and you may attend and vote at the AGM. Harvest Supper in 2 days! Posted on October 22, 2015 by ecoviewfinder. Celebrating 6 years of Transition Leytonstone. Peasant Wedding by Pieter Brueghel the Elder (1567). Believe it or not, 6 years have gone by since the inception of Transition Leytonstone on September 28th, 2009! To celebrate both our birthday and the success of the Market Stall we’ve been running in partnership with OrganicLea. We’re holding a Harvest Supper on Saturday 24th October at St. John’s Church.
